**Sorting stability — Relay Reports builder.** The builder must produce identical row order across re-renders, so every sort is made stable by appending the internal row key as a final tiebreaker. For large result sets we switch from in-memory merge sort to the external spill sorter; reviewers should confirm the tiebreaker survives the spill path. The thresholds controlling that switchover and chunk sizing are defined below.

constants for tageg-kagag:
QUOTAS = {
    "kelax": 495,
    "istath": 366,
    "tammir": 108,
    "novdor": 730,
    "casax": 816,
    "quenael": 874,
    "pelius": 403,
}

Team,

Welcome aboard to those who joined this week. Last night we completed the cut-over of Calcgrove's formula engine to the new sandbox. User-supplied formulas now execute inside isolated workers with strict CPU and memory ceilings, no filesystem access, and a frozen builtin table. We replayed a week of production formulas beforehand; only three hit the new limits, all pathological. Rollback remains possible for seven days via the old evaluator flag. The sandbox launched with the configuration shown below.

deployment values, yadug-bawif:
[framir]
team = pelox
access_code = ac_a38ab2
owner = tamion.julael
host = framir.tolvaqlabs.test
port = 11211
peer = tammir.zemvargrid.local
salt = 2215ef03
pin = 1541

## Account Recovery — Cron Migration Note

Legacy cron jobs for account recovery at Tollbrook have moved to the Wendel workflow engine. Recovery tokens are now issued by the `acct-restore` workflow, not the nightly crontab. Reviewers should confirm the old crontab entries are disabled. To unlock the recovery operator account during review, enter the passphrase below.

vault phrase of kafog-kahif = holdor-rusir-praox

Handover: Validator plugin system

Hey — welcome aboard. Quick brain dump on Checkstone's validator plugins before I'm out. Validators are discovered at startup from the plugin directory, loaded in priority order, and each one declares which record types it handles. Failures are soft by default, so a broken plugin logs and skips rather than blocking ingestion. Don't touch the loader itself; just add plugins. The loader config currently in use is shown here.

deployment values, taweg-bajop:
[fenvan]
port = 5672
team = holmir
host = fenvan.orvexio.example
region = lower-1
access_code = ac_b98bc6
timeout_ms = 1500